Brief Summary

Official Title: “Early Diagnosis of Asthma in Young Children”

Condition Keyword(s):

The overall aim of the study is an early asthma diagnosis in young children by the use of non-invasive biomarkers of airway inflammation /oxidative stress in exhaled air, and early lung function measurements

Study Type: Interventional

Study Design: Diagnostic, Randomized, Open Label, Uncontrolled, Parallel Assignment, Efficacy Study

Study Primary Completion Date: April 2011

Intervention(s) in this Clinical Trial

  • Drug: beclomethasondipropionate
    • 2 x 100 ug dd for two months, via aerochamber

Outcome Measures for this Clinical Trial

Primary Measures

  • - definite asthma diagnosis - biomarkers in exhaled breath
    • Time Frame: 6 years of age
      Safety Issue?: Yes

Criteria for Participation in this Clinical Trial

Inclusion Criteria:

  • Children aged 2-3 years, with recurrent respiratory symptoms suggestive of asthma
  • Children aged 2-3 years, with no or minor respiratory symptoms

Exclusion Criteria:

  • Mental retardation
  • Cardiac anomalies
  • Congenital malformations
  • Other diseases of the lungs/airways
  • Chronic systemic inflammatory diseases like M. Crohn
  • The inability to perform lung function measurements and/or exhaled air collection

Gender Eligibility for this Clinical Trial: Both

Minimum Age for this Clinical Trial: 2 Years

Maximum Age for this Clinical Trial: 4 Years

Are Healthy Volunteers Accepted for this Clinical Trial?: Accepts Healthy Volunteers
